                                        History-themed programming at Cahill School and Minnehaha Grange No. 398 are offered by the Edina Historical Society. Both buildings are listed on the National Register of Historic Places and owned by the City of Edina.


                                        Schoolmarms' day camp offers old-fashioned fun

                                        Enroll your child in the Cahill Schoolmarms Summer Day Camp for a week in June 2012. The same costumed schoolmarms who enchant children with “trips” back to a school day in 1900 will supervise the Summer Day Camp. A typical camp day will include activities such as turn-of-century songs and stories, moral virtues and rhymes, mystery items, group games, and arts & crafts projects related to the historical theme.

                                        Suggested Ages: Ages 7 to 11.
                                        Number of Children in each camp session: 20
                                        Cost: $125 per child per week including fee for camp supplies.
                                        Lunch: Campers should bring a bag lunch and a water bottle.
                                        Attire: Campers may dress as pioneers – but that’s optional.

                                        Dates and times:
                                        Camp will run Monday through Thursday from 9:30 a.m. to 1:30 p.m. each day. Sessions are identical.

                                        Session 1: June 11 to 14
                                        Session 2: June 18 to 21
                                        Session 3: June 25 to 28
